Output 804c590b831b10281f7d0907242dbee68b2df20703d74fc1f22cb9cb0f2f1f26:0

value
2744148
script pubkey
OP_HASH160 OP_PUSHBYTES_20 810770888025b7234566e5288fef41968c2d6e26 OP_EQUAL
address
3DTG1CcwTycH83X8LFyAtnzPdwgoy3c6vW
transaction
804c590b831b10281f7d0907242dbee68b2df20703d74fc1f22cb9cb0f2f1f26
spent
true